Transaction ce24d9853fd5cdca5e14c3fec1b95b2a1ab70079a8078d83edc6d3dbeb15709b

block
f3edaef88cccfcadbbf1760b825eff7bcad8f885d52e035aecbe21b14cce358f

1 Input

16 Outputs